"It Is Either Igbo President 2019 or Biafra 2020" - Ohaneze youths
In a communiqué issued signed by the Secretary General of OYC, Mazi Okwu Nnabuike, and issued after a meeting in Enugu, the group said Ndigbo would no longer play second fiddle in Nigeria politics.
According to the Ohaneze, “it is Igbo president 2019 or Biafra 2020”. The group argued that the Igbos have been marginalized and denied the mantle of political power for years.
The communiqué stated in part, “Two days ago, the acting President, Prof. Yemi Osinbajo re-echoed the fact that Nigeria is in a marriage. He was quoted as saying that our nation has been in marriage for a while now. Sometimes, there are quarrels within that marriage. Sometimes there is disagreement. What is important is that you must remain together. You must remain united.
“It does appear from the above that Ndigbo have perpetually remained the sacrificial lamb to keep this forced marriage together. They have remained victims of an abusive marriage, often beaten, cheated by the husband”
“We have resolved today that this grave injustice cannot continue. It is Igbo presidency in 2019 with a Vice President from the North or nothing. “We are not ready any longer to be treated with levity and disdain in this country and for that we are calling on all Igbo sons and daughters both at home and in the Diaspora to key into this project”.
